Output a66ddfdfb94c351689843c0d5e52a14380e90cccb280ae67033fcc2e7a487974:0

value
171065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758cef77af6f3e12f78e7fa6725f070440211672 OP_EQUAL
address
3CQZpMQHb38wy6kbN93VQRbqnmBxwTwFZC
transaction
a66ddfdfb94c351689843c0d5e52a14380e90cccb280ae67033fcc2e7a487974
spent
false

3 Sat Ranges